Long-tubes make it easier to work on.... Instead of having this big mess of piping in your engine bay, that looks a lot like a bowl of spaghetti, it will all go down, equaling out the length towards the trans. I had a set of Mac equals on my 302, put hooker longs on my 351, have twice as much space under the hood even with the wider engine. Can change all the plugs in 10 minutes, where-as, with my Macs... we won't even go there.
